8. Features and Applications
• user friendly
• Can be controlled anywhere in the world.
• Non-volatile memory based energy-reading
storing.
• Auto disconnect feature.
• Electricity departments.
• Household Energy meter monitoring.
• Railway electrical systems.
• Industrial Energy remote monitoring
9. Advantages of GSM based AMR
• Precise consumption information
• Clear and accurate billing
• Automatic outage information and
faster recovery
• Better and faster customer service
10. Dis-Advantages of GSM based AMR
• GSM network’s Failures
• Expensive to implement this system
• GSM modem battery failures
14. Conclusion
• The development of GSM based energy meter demonstrates
the concept and implementation of new power metering
system.
• It not only solve the problem of manual meter reading but
also provide additional feature such as power disconnect,
power connect , power cut alert and tempering alert
customer can also pay bill via online login on authenticated
web.
